WebBlepharitis, pronounced bleh-fur- RY -tis, means inflammation of the eyelid. The edges of your lids turn red or dark in color and become swollen and scaly. Blepharitis usually affects both eyes. It can happen when a skin condition causes irritation, when you develop an infection or when oil glands become clogged. Viral conjunctivitis can cause a … WebOct 15, 2024 · A swollen tear duct can result from an infection or a blockage. Symptoms of a swollen tear duct include excessive tearing, eye discharge, chronic nasal infections, or injury. Self-care measures such as warm compresses are often effective for unblocking the duct. WebJan 16, 2024 · There are many reasons dogs can develop conjunctivitis and red eyes, with infections being just one of the possibilities. Allergens, such as tree, grass, flower, and other pollens, can cause itchiness, redness, and discharge in dog eyes. Allergies are one of the most common causes of red eye in dogs.
